directions

  • Cook bacon in large skillet until crisp.
  • Remove bacon, crumble, and set aside.
  • Drain drippings, reserving 2 tablespoons in skillet.
  • Add potatoes, green peppers, onion, salt, and pepper to drippings.
  • Cook and stir for 2 minutes.
  • Cover and cook, stirring occasionally, until potatoes are brown and tender (about 15 minutes).
  • Make 6 wells in potatoes and break one egg into each well.
  • Cover and cook on low heat 8-10 minutes, or until eggs are completely set.
  • Sprinkle with cheese and bacon.
